An electric heating pad uses internal coils to produce various levels of heat based on the user’s setting. Though many models plug into a wall outlet, others use a battery pack for power. Battery-powered products may be more convenient for people who require a heating pad on the go. Many electric … See more Infrared heating pads also use electricity. However, infrared products convert electricity to infrared light, which produces heat.
